A matched set of four 18th Century candlesticks
cast with shells and fluting, each on a rising shaped square base and with a baluster stem, waisted socket decorated with narrow rope-twist friezes, and a detachable shell-decorated nozzle, the underside of each scratch-engraved with initials, various maker's, London 1756, 1762 and 1773 - 10in. (25.50cm.) and smaller, 72.50oz.
